GTAW Applied Procedures and Safety

Develop practical GTAW skills through hands-on instruction in TIG welding procedures, equipment setup, joint preparation, and weld execution across multiple positions on carbon steel, stainless steel, and aluminum. Emphasizing shop safety, inspection routines, and professional work habits, this course prepares learners to produce quality welds while meeting industry expectations for safe welding operations.
